Description Suggest change

Was recommended to do this route by some locals at the campground suggesting it was 11a.  Felt about 10+/11-.  Start with a right facing dihedral slab to gain the obvious crack system. Jam your way up perfect hands for a few moves before heading left on to the face.  Great edges til you hit the roof to do some laybacking out left. Bomber holds to to fully rock over.  Easy moves to the chains.

Location Suggest change

Left of watery tart on the arete of the right leaning arch.  This is the left most bolt line starting from the arch.  

Protection Suggest change

14 bolts to biner anchor
